
Giantswarm
Profile
Giant Swarm is a fully managed Kubernetes platform that abstracts operational complexity while maintaining enterprise control and flexibility. Built on open-source foundations with Apache 2.0 licensing, it provides a comprehensive solution for managing cloud-native infrastructure at scale. The platform combines cluster lifecycle management, observability, and security capabilities with 24/7 expert support. Its value proposition centers on enabling organizations to leverage Kubernetes without building and maintaining internal platform engineering expertise, offering a bridge between infrastructure complexity and developer productivity.
Focus
Giant Swarm addresses the fundamental challenge of managing Kubernetes infrastructure at enterprise scale. The platform eliminates the operational burden of maintaining multiple Kubernetes clusters while preserving flexibility and control. It serves platform engineering teams who need to provide consistent, secure, and reliable infrastructure across multiple environments and cloud providers. Key benefits include reduced operational overhead, standardized cluster lifecycle management, and the ability to focus on strategic initiatives rather than infrastructure maintenance. The solution particularly suits organizations requiring multi-cluster management with strong security and compliance controls.
Background
Giant Swarm emerged from the founders' experience at Adcloud, where they processed over ten thousand transactions per second and found existing PaaS solutions inadequate for their scale. Founded in 2014, the company transformed their internal infrastructure management solution into a product as Kubernetes gained prominence. The platform has demonstrated its capabilities through notable deployments, including Adidas's e-commerce platform and Vodafone's global cloud-native transformation. The company remains independently owned by its original founders, maintaining active development with approximately 80 employees and a strong open-source commitment.
Main features
Dual-cluster architecture with centralized management
The platform implements a clear separation between management and workload execution through a dual-cluster model. The management cluster serves as the control plane, hosting operators and controllers for orchestrating workload cluster lifecycle management using Cluster API. Workload clusters maintain complete isolation, running in dedicated network environments with separate cloud provider accounts when required. This architecture enables organizations to scale Kubernetes operations while maintaining security boundaries and operational oversight, supporting sophisticated disaster recovery and geographic distribution strategies.
GitOps-driven configuration management
The platform employs a sophisticated layered configuration approach managed through GitOps principles using Flux. This system enables platform teams to define baseline configurations across all clusters, overlay environment-specific settings, and allow cluster-level customization while maintaining consistency. Configuration management supports inheritance and composition patterns, reducing duplication while providing clarity about applied settings. The GitOps workflow ensures all changes are version-controlled, peer-reviewed, and easily reversible, with automated reconciliation maintaining desired state.
Comprehensive observability and security framework
The platform integrates a complete observability stack based on the Grafana LGTM suite, providing unified visibility across infrastructure, applications, and security domains. The multi-tenant observability system enables teams to access relevant metrics, logs, and traces while maintaining strict data isolation. Security controls implement defense-in-depth principles, including cluster isolation, network policies, Pod Security Standards, and RBAC integration with enterprise identity providers. The framework supports sophisticated access control models mapping organizational structure to Kubernetes permissions.







